So, the bathroom floor. While we were looking over the new place before moving in, the first thing I noticed was that the floor in the bathroom was damaged as hell from water. The toilet was sinking into the floor on the right side and was leaning far enough that it made the tank drain drip by drop and refill itself repeatedly all day long. No fun. Long story short [too late], the front end of the tub, the end with the faucets, had settled into the floor and tilted the wrong way so that instead of the water running to the corner of the tub where it can sit and drain back into the tub and not cause problems it was running to the other edge out on to the floor and soaking into the floor. This probably would not have been such a big deal, but, instead of plywood the floor had been cheaply redone at some point and they used OSB [Sterling board] which acts like a sponge as soon as it gets wet, apparently. So, instead of the water drying up, it was trapped in the OSB and just causing as much water damage as it could. But, anyway, replaced the floor where it was damaged, and now my toilet is level!
